A Superconducting Magnet System for Free-Electron Cyclotron Maser (Selected Portions),

Abstract

The superconducting magnet system is a important part of the free-electron cyclotron maser. In tris paper a new super conducting magnet system is designed and tested. It consists of a main superconducting magnet, a gradient superconducting magnet, a normal magnet, a cryostat and some other accessories. The advantages of the designated magnet system are small in size, high stable magnet field and suitable field profile. It is very suitable for 4 mm wave free-electron cyclotron maser.
